西门子802D数控系统代理商-成都
有一种力量,正在支持我们前行,源于博大精深,同心致远。
浔之漫智控技术(上海)有限公司长期低价销售西门子PLC200.300.400.S1200.S1500.ET200.Smart200,6SE70变频器.70备件.6SY7000/7010.C98面板,6RA70/28/24直流调速器,6XV电缆,6EP电源,3RW30/40/44软启动器,6AV人机触摸屏,LOGO!,6SL系列G110.G120.S120.V10.V20,MM440/430/420变频,6DR阀门定位器,7ML.7ME.7MF.7MH仪表仪器,6FC.6SN伺服数控,电机等西门子系列产品
① 接收到的字节数(字节字段)
② 起始字符
③ 消息
④ 结束字符
⑤ 消息字符
如果中断例程连接到接收消息完成事件,CPU 会在接收完缓冲区的*后一个字符后生成
中断(对于端口 0 为中断事件 23,对于端口 1 为中断事件 24)。
可以不使用中断,而通过监视 SMB86(端口 0)或 SMB186(端口 1)来接收消息。如
果接收指令未激活或已终止,该字节不为零。正在接收时,该字节为零。
如下表所示,接收指令允许您选择消息开始和结束条件,对于端口 0 使用 SMB86 到
SMB94,对于端口 1 使用 SMB186 到 SMB194。
说明
如果出现组帧错误、奇偶校验错误、超限错误或断开错误,则接收消息功能将自动终止。
必须定义开始条件和结束条件(*大字符数),这样接收消息功能才能运行。
接收指令使用接收消息控制字节(SMB87 或 SMB187)中的位来定义消息开始和结束条
件。
执行接收指令时,如果通信端口上有来自其它设备的通信,则接收消息功能可能会从该字
符的中间开始接收字符,从而导致奇偶校验错误或组帧错误以及接收消息功能终止。如果
未启用奇偶校验,收到的消息可能包含错误字符。将开始条件指定为特定起始字符或任何
字符时,可能会发生这种情况,如下文中的第 2 项和第 6 项所述。
接收指令支持多种消息开始条件。指定与断开或空闲线检测相关的开始条件,并在将字符
放入消息缓冲区之前强制接收消息功能将消息开始与字符开始同步,这样可避免出现从字
符的中间开始消息的问题。
联系方式
- 地址:上海松江 上海市松江区石湖荡镇塔汇路755弄29号1幢一层A区213室
- 邮编:201600
- 联系电话:未提供
- 经理:吴悦
- 手机:19514718569
- QQ:2810544350
- Email:2810544350@qq.com